After its final bye week of the season, No. 3 Penn State returns to the field on Saturday for its final game in October and second consecutive contest on the road. The Nittany Lions meet Wisconsin (5-2) on Saturday inside of a likely sold-out Camp Randall Stadium. Head coach James Franklin’s team is perfect at this point, as it brings a 6-0 record into Madison. Head coach Luke Fickell’s Badgers, meanwhile, are amid a three-game winning streak.

“The bye week was good,” Franklin said this week. “Was able to get a ton of work done not only from a self-scout perspective, but also really from a recruiting perspective as well. Obviously this is going to be a big week for us. Obviously a lot of history with this program. A ton of respect for their head coach. Obviously he’s a Big Ten guy for most of his career, a player and as a coach. He’s done a nice job wherever he has been.

“I think really the last three weeks they’ve played their best football. They’re really coming on right now. Just watching them on tape how clean they’re playing, how hard they’re playing, it’s impressive to watch.”

Penn State at Wisconsin Game time and details

Penn State is 11-9 all-time against Wisconsin. The Nittany Lions are amid a five-game winning streak in the series dating back to 2012. PSU last met the Badgers in primetime for the 2016 Big Ten title game, which Franklin’s team came back to win at Lucas Oil Stadium in Indianapolis, of course. The sides last met in Madison in 2021, when PSU took a 16-0 triumph to start that season.

Here are the details for this year’s matchup:

Time: 7:30 p.m. ET
Date: Saturday, Oct. 26
Location: Camp Randall Stadium in Madison, Wisc.
Weather: A terrific day and night appear to be on tap. Here’s the latest forecast: “Sunshine and some clouds. High 57F. Winds N at 5 to 10 mph.” The low is 36 degrees Fahrenheit. Rain will not be a factor.
The line: Penn State is a 6.5-point favorite.
Over/under: 47.5 points

How to watch, stream Lions-Badgers

Penn State will be on NBC for the second time this season. It last was when it beat Illinois in primetime at the end of September. All-time, the Lions are 9-3 on NBC

The PSU-Wisconsin game will be called by Noah Eagle (play-by-play), Penn State alum Todd Blackledge, (color commentary), and Kathryn Tappen (sideline reporter).

The Penn State Sports Network will also be on the radio airwaves with Steve Jones, Jack Ham, and Brian Tripp. It airs on 99.5 & 103.7 FM/1450 AM locally and at GoPSUSports.com online.
